Bread comprised of 100% rye flour, well known in northern Europe, is often leavened with sourdough. Baker's yeast will not be helpful for a leavening agent for rye bread, as rye doesn't incorporate enough gluten. The construction of rye bread is based totally on the starch from the flour and also other carbohydrates often known as pentosans; even so, rye amylase is Energetic at substantially bigger temperatures than wheat amylase, creating the framework with the bread to disintegrate since the starches are damaged down through baking. The reduced pH of the sourdough starter, hence, inactivates the amylases when heat can't, allowing the carbohydrates while in the bread to gel and set correctly.

Mainly because of the period of time sourdough bread takes to evidence, lots of bakers may perhaps refrigerate their loaves prior to baking. This process is called 'retardation' to decelerate the proofing system. This method has the included benefit of building a richer flavoured bread.[citation wanted]
